Proje Özeti

"Project scheduling studies usually ignores random factors that would affect the implementation and profitability of the project. Some stochastic project scheduling studies address uncertainty by modeling the uncertainty in activity durations. However, projects are affected by other uncertain factors, such as disruptions in resource usages/availabilities or delays in cash flows. In this project, we investigate the uncertainties associated with delays in client payments and model the effects of these in the net present value (NPV), which is a common criterion used to assess the financial feasibility of the projects. Our study will be the first one that considers this type of uncertainty in the project scheduling literature. We formulated our project scheduling problem as a two-stage stochastic mixed integer program. The activity start times are the main decision variables in the model. The actual client payment times are represented as second-stage decision variables. The objective function maximizes the expected NPV. We are planning to solve the resulting formulation using a sample average approximation algorithm.We will conduct computational experiments to illustrate the impact of uncertain delay in client payments into the activity start times. We will assess the value of stochastic solution. Finally, we will examine the effect of the deadline constraint on the net present value and optimal activity start times."
